4-Day Tokyo Adventure

Monday, April 15: Exploring Historic Tokyo

Start your trip by immersing yourself in the rich history of Tokyo. In the morning, visit the magnificent Meiji Shrine, nestled in a serene forest. Experience the tranquility as you explore the shrine grounds and learn about Japanese traditions. In the afternoon, head to the historic Asakusa district and marvel at the iconic Senso-ji Temple, Tokyo's oldest Buddhist temple. Take a leisurely stroll through Nakamise Shopping Street, known for its traditional snacks and souvenirs. End your day with a visit to the Tokyo Skytree, offering breathtaking views of the city at sunset.

  • Meiji Shrine: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2 hours
  • Senso-ji Temple: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2 hours
  • Tokyo Skytree: Estimated cost - ¥2,060 ($19), Time spent - 2 hours
Tuesday, April 16: Modern Tokyo Exploration

Embark on a journey through modern Tokyo. Start your day by visiting the bustling Shibuya Crossing, one of the world's busiest intersections. Experience the vibrant energy as you cross the street and explore the trendy shops and cafes in Shibuya. In the afternoon, make your way to the famous Harajuku district, known for its unique fashion and quirky street culture. Explore Takeshita Street and indulge in delightful street food. As the evening approaches, head to Shinjuku Gyoen National Garden, a peaceful oasis in the heart of the city, perfect for a relaxing stroll.

  • Shibuya Crossing: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2 hours
  • Harajuku: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2 hours
  • Shinjuku Gyoen National Garden: Estimated cost - ¥500 ($5), Time spent - 2 hours
Wednesday, April 17: Cultural Tokyo Experience

Immerse yourself in the vibrant culture of Tokyo. Begin your day in the historic district of Ueno. Visit the Ueno Park, home to several museums, including the Tokyo National Museum, where you can explore Japanese art and history. In the afternoon, discover the traditional neighborhood of Yanaka. Wander through its charming streets, lined with old wooden houses and small temples. Indulge in local street food and explore the unique shops. As the sun sets, head to Kabukicho in Shinjuku, Tokyo's entertainment district, and witness the dazzling neon lights.

  • Ueno Park: Estimated cost - ¥620 ($6), Time spent - 3 hours
  • Yanaka: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2 hours
  • Kabukicho: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2 hours
Thursday, April 18: Nature and Serenity

Escape the bustling city and embrace nature's beauty in Tokyo. Start your day with a visit to the enchanting Odaiba Seaside Park, offering stunning views of Tokyo Bay. Explore the lush greenery and enjoy a relaxing picnic. In the afternoon, make your way to the tranquil Hamarikyu Gardens, where you can experience traditional Japanese landscaping and enjoy a peaceful tea ceremony. End your day with a visit to the Tokyo Sea Life Park, home to a variety of marine species, where you can learn about Japan's rich marine life.

  • Odaiba Seaside Park: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 3 hours
  • Hamarikyu Gardens: Estimated cost - ¥300 ($3), Time spent - 2 hours
  • Tokyo Sea Life Park: Estimated cost - ¥700 ($7), Time spent - 2 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

When in Tokyo, don't miss the opportunity to visit Shimokitazawa, a bohemian neighborhood known for its vintage shops, live music venues, and trendy cafes. Experience the unique atmosphere as you explore the narrow streets filled with creativity and artistic expression. Another hidden gem is Yanaka Cemetery, a peaceful oasis surrounded by cherry blossom trees. Take a stroll through this serene cemetery and admire the beauty of nature.
